19.4.
Additional VP6800 Information
19.4.1.
Settings Menu
To access the settings menu:
1.
Reset the VP6800.
2.
Before the screen loads, quickly press the top-right corner of the screen, then do a long press
in the top-left corner.
The device loads the settings menu.
19.4.2.
Press-and-hold Events
The area that detects press-and-hold events is 70px*70px and always at the top-left and top-right
screen corners.
If a user presses-and-holds for 1 second, the device registers and sends an Object Event Call Back for
a long press event (refer to 3.5).
